在CSS中,我們可以使用多種方法來(lái)改變?cè)氐奈恢?,以下是一些常?jiàn)的方法:
1、使用margin屬性:通過(guò)調(diào)整元素的margin,我們可以改變?cè)嘏c周圍元素之間的空間,從而間接地改變?cè)氐奈恢茫黾釉氐膍argin-top可以使其向下移動(dòng)。
2、使用padding屬性:與margin類似,調(diào)整元素的padding也可以改變?cè)氐奈恢?,通過(guò)增加元素的padding,可以使其內(nèi)部的內(nèi)容更加緊湊,從而改變其在頁(yè)面上的位置。
3、使用position屬性:CSS中的position屬性可以指定元素在頁(yè)面上的位置類型,將position設(shè)置為relative可以將元素相對(duì)于其正常位置進(jìn)行移動(dòng),還可以通過(guò)調(diào)整top、right、bottom和left屬性來(lái)進(jìn)一步微調(diào)元素的位置。
4、使用float屬性:float屬性可以使元素浮動(dòng)到其父元素的左側(cè)或右側(cè),從而改變其在頁(yè)面上的位置,需要注意的是,使用float屬性時(shí)需要清除浮動(dòng),否則可能會(huì)影響其他元素的布局。
5、使用flex布局:CSS中的flex布局是一種強(qiáng)大的布局工具,可以輕松地創(chuàng)建復(fù)雜的布局結(jié)構(gòu),通過(guò)調(diào)整flex容器的flex-direction、justify-content和align-items等屬性,可以輕松地改變?cè)氐奈恢煤筒季址绞健?/p>
除了以上方法外,還可以通過(guò)調(diào)整元素的width、height、line-height等屬性來(lái)進(jìn)一步微調(diào)元素的位置和布局,還可以使用CSS中的其他***特性,如grid布局、transform屬性等來(lái)實(shí)現(xiàn)更復(fù)雜的布局效果。
在CSS中改變?cè)氐奈恢糜卸喾N方法可供選擇,我們可以根據(jù)具體的需求和場(chǎng)景來(lái)選擇***適合的方法來(lái)實(shí)現(xiàn)所需的布局效果。